Aquarium of the Pacific: Behind-the-Scenes Private Tour

Go beyond the exhibits at one of North America's finest aquariums with a private behind-the-scenes experience — feeding sharks, touching sea jellies, and standing backstage with marine biologists. Just minutes from the cruise terminal.

What to expect

A marine biologist escort takes you behind the public exhibits into the holding and treatment areas — places the general public never sees. You'll hand-feed a bamboo shark in Shark Lagoon, watch sea otter enrichment training up close, and get a briefing on Pacific conservation efforts straight from researchers. The main galleries — Blue Cavern, Tropical Pacific, the Honda Pacific Visions Theater — are yours to explore at leisure before or after. Good to know

The aquarium is just 3 miles from the World Cruise Center — a 10-minute rideshare or taxi. No rental car needed. Behind-the-scenes slots are limited to small groups; book the add-on online well ahead. Open daily from 9 AM, making an early start easy.
